Two Hackers Are Convicted for Infecting over 400,000 Computers with Malware and Stealing Millions

A federal jury convicted two hackers on 21 counts of cybercrimes including infecting computers with malware to steal credit card information. The culprits also attempted to sell sensitive data on dark web marketplaces, engaged in online fraud and illegally mined digital currencies.

Romanian duo convicted in US for using cryptocurrency malware-mining to steal millions

Two Romanian residents have been convicted of infecting over 400,000 individual computers with malware in order to mine cryptocurrency and steal victims’ data to sell on the dark web. Bogdan Nicolescu, 36, and Radu Miclaus, 37, were convicted by a US jury following a 12-day trial of conspiracy to commit wire fraud, conspiracy to traffic in counterfeit service marks, aggravated identity theft, conspiracy to commit money laundering, and 12 counts each of wire fraud.
